Lead Java Developer - Glasgow, United Kingdom - Anson McCade Ltd - IT and Finance Recruitment

Tom O´Connor

Posted by:

Tom O´Connor

beBee Recruiter


Description

My Client, a global leader in consulting, tech services and digital transformation is at the forefront of innovation who's main objective is to address the entire breadth of their clients opportunities in the evolving world of cloud, digital and platforms.

They have a heritage that spans over 50 years with a deep understanding of industry-specific problems and are now needing a Lead Java Developer to join their ever evolving work-force.


As a Lead Java Developer you will be joining and leading small teams of highly skilled engineers who specialise in agile custom software development.


Lead Java Developer Role

  • You'll ensure projects are delivered on time and on budget.
  • You'll ensure that functional and nonfunctional requirements are appropriately implemented What you'll bring

Lead Java Developer Requirements

  • Experience of the core XP practices of TDD, Pair Programming, and Continuous Integration
  • Demonstrable experience in one or more technology stacks, e.g. Spring (e.g. Core, MVC, Data, Boot/Cloud), Integration Technologies (Spring Integration, Apache Camel, REST, Messaging), Spring Framework 5 (preferably with experience of Spring Boot, SpringIntegration, Spring Batch, Hystrix)
  • Experience of Websphere (or experience with alternative JEE App servers e.g. JBoss, Glassfish)
  • Hands on development experience with hibernate, quartz and bootstrap technologies and Microsoft SQL Server
  • Experience of Bitbucket (or experience with alternative GIT repositories e.g. GitHub, GitLab)
  • Experience of Jenkins (or experience with alternative CICD e.g. TeamCity, Bamboo, Drone)
  • Experience of Artifactory (or experience with alternative Binary Management e.g. Nexus, Archiva)
  • Experience of working in collaborative teams
  • Experience in pragmatic architecture
  • SC Cleared or Clearable Desirable

Lead Java Developer Desirable

  • Java 8 and dependency injection, building asynchronous microservices with RESTful APIs
  • JAX-RS for REST APIs
  • JMS
  • NoSQL
  • JavaScript frameworks (e.g. ReactJS, NodeJS, Angular)
  • Automated testing with Junit and Mockito
  • Designing microservicebased architectures using domain driven design (DDD), CQRS and Event Sourcing patterns
  • Containerisation technologies: Docker or Kubernetes
  • JIRA / Confluence
  • Python
  • Powershell
  • Chef
  • IBM ODM Rules development
MSA/JAVA/CG/ 17/11

Lead Java Developer

More jobs from Anson McCade Ltd - IT and Finance Recruitment